Industrialization Engineer
Function
We are looking for an Industrialization Engineer to strengthen the Tools and Process Engineering Team. As Industrialization Engineer you will play a critical role in the transition of new products from development into mass production. From the start of the project, you will be part of a project team to follow the introduction of new products (NPI), setting up and optimizing manufacturing processes, define and develop tools/machines that are required to produce the new products. The role requires a hands-on approach, a deep understanding of the manufacturing processes and the ability to work cross-functionally with designers, quality engineers, line supervisors, production operators, supply chain, ….
Key Responsibilities
- New Product Introduction (NPI):
- Collaborate with design engineering teams (worldwide) to ensure that new product designs are manufacturable at scale.
- Perform design for manufacturing (DFM) and design for (automated) assembly (DFA/DFAA) analysis on new products and processes to ensure the design is fit for mass production
- Follow up alfa, beta and zero series
- Monitor production runs to identify and resolve any issues that may affect product quality or schedule adherence.
- Work closely with quality team and production team to ensure that all products meet required standards before moving to full-scale production.
- Create draft work instructions.
- Develop and deliver training for operators on new processes, equipment and products.
- Ensure training of repair technicians and maintenance team.
- Process and tool development:
- Design, develop and implement new manufacturing processes to produce new products.
- Define, develop, order, build and install assembly tools and/or machines/test systems
- Maintain detailed documentation of all processes/tools, changes and improvements.
- Ensure compliance with industry standards, safety regulations and company policies.
- Create/define maintenance, calibration and process control instructions for the developed tools and processes
- Continuous Improvement:
- Continuously improve existing manufacturing processes to increase efficiency, improve product quality and reduce cost.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ement corrective actions and preventive measures.
- Provide ongoing support to production teams (typically 2nd level) to troubleshoot issues and ensure process adherence.
